Prof. Dr. Andreas Victor Walser is an Associate Professor for the History of Ancient Civilizations from the Eastern Mediterranean to the Near East at the Department of History, University of Zurich, since 2022. His research focuses on Greek epigraphy, socio-ecological systems, and economic/religious history of antiquity.
- Chair of Ancient Cultures (Eastern Mediterranean to Middle East)
- Digital epigraphy projects: 'iPergamon' (SNSF-funded) and supplement volume of Pergamon inscriptions
His research examines Greek inscriptions as primary sources for political, economic, and religious structures in the Hellenistic and Roman periods, with key areas including the Pergamon micro-region, socio-ecological interaction, and legal continuity in Byzantine inscriptions. Publications include analyses of legal foundations, euergetism, and urban consolidation processes.
Scientific awards include a Volkswagen Foundation Post-Doctoral Fellowship and SNSF grant leadership. Collaborations span the German Archaeological Institute, University of Groningen, and epigraphic projects in Turkey. He teaches and publishes extensively on ancient economics, legal history, and interdisciplinary approaches to classical studies.
